It sounds as though what Mr. Prieto wants to do is execute a non unix system's
cat equivalent (eg: "type") and save the screen output, getting a file transfer
system.  This is certainly a reasonable thing to do, but I have had little
success with Mr. Fiedler's  "cu | tee" solution.  Characters seem to drop out
like crazy.  If you have access to any 4.2 utilities, 'tip(1)' is what you want.
This is a much improved cu rewrite, (Really cu exists only as an entry to tip
in 4.2), and has commands tailor made for this sort of thing. (~<)
It's great for logins over hard uucp lines and modem fiddling too!
